Expanded polystyrene (EPS) is a lightweight yet incredibly strong material that has become an essential component in construction projects EPS 200, a specific type of EPS, is known for its high density and superior insulation properties, making it a popular choice for builders and contractors around the world.
One of the main advantages of using EPS 200 in construction projects is its strength-to-weight ratio Despite being lightweight, EPS 200 is extremely durable and can support heavy loads without compromising the structural integrity of a building This makes it an ideal material for constructing walls, floors, and roofs that need to withstand various external forces, such as wind, snow, and earthquakes.
Additionally, EPS 200 is an excellent insulator, providing superior thermal and acoustic performance Its closed-cell structure traps air inside, creating a barrier that helps regulate indoor temperatures and reduce energy consumption This can lead to significant cost savings on heating and cooling bills, making EPS 200 a sustainable choice for environmentally conscious builders.
Another benefit of EPS 200 is its versatility It can be easily molded into different shapes and sizes, making it suitable for a wide range of construction applications Whether used as insulation panels, formwork blocks, or decorative elements, EPS 200 can be customized to meet the specific requirements of a project, saving time and labor costs in the process.
In addition to its strength, insulation properties, and versatility, EPS 200 is also a cost-effective material for construction projects Its affordability compared to traditional building materials, such as concrete or steel, makes it an attractive option for builders looking to maximize their budget without compromising on quality Furthermore, the lightweight nature of EPS 200 reduces transportation costs and simplifies installation, further lowering overall project expenses.
